高校运动会成绩管理系统链表
时间: 2023-10-24 08:08:55 浏览: 51
链表是一种常用的数据结构,用于存储和管理数据。在高校运动会成绩管理系统中,链表可以用来存储和管理运动员的信息。
根据引用中的描述,运动员信息模块可以被划分为多个小模块,其中包括输入模块、修改模块、查询模块、删除模块和退出系统模块。这些模块可以使用链表来实现。
使用链表来管理运动员的信息有以下几个优点:
1. 动态存储:链表可以根据需要动态增加或删除节点,适应不同大小的数据量。
2. 灵活性:链表可以在任何位置插入或删除节点,方便对运动员信息的修改和查询。
3. 效率:链表的插入和删除操作的时间复杂度为O(1),比使用数组等其他数据结构更高效。
在链表中,每个节点代表一个运动员的信息,包括姓名、年龄、项目、成绩等。每个节点还包含一个指针,指向下一个节点,以实现链表的链接。
通过链表,你可以实现各种功能,如添加运动员信息、修改运动员信息、查询运动员信息、删除运动员信息等。这些功能可以通过调用链表上的相应操作函数来实现,比如添加节点、修改节点、查找节点、删除节点等。
总之,链表是一种适合用于高校运动会成绩管理系统的数据结构,它可以方便地存储和管理运动员的信息,并提供各种功能供用户使用。<span class="em">1</span><span class="em">2</span>
#### 引用[.reference_title]
- *1* *2* [C语言课程设计_运动会管理系统](https://blog.csdn.net/NBITer/article/details/128601433)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]